site stats

Left diagonal of a matrix

NettetDescription. D = diag (v) returns a square diagonal matrix with the elements of vector v on the main diagonal. D = diag (v,k) places the elements of vector v on the k th diagonal. k=0 represents the main … Nettet31. jul. 2024 · The diagonal of a square matrix running from the upper right entities to the lower-left entities is called the counter diagonal of a matrix. Here, Counter diagonal …

java - Extracting a list of all diagonals from a matrix in a specific ...

NettetIn linear algebra, the main diagonal(sometimes principal diagonal, primary diagonal, leading diagonal, major diagonal, or good diagonal) of a matrixA{\displaystyle A}is the … NettetA square matrix have two diagonals: Left Diagonal: The row and column indexes of a left diagonal element are equal i.e. i==j. Right Diagonal: The sum of the row and column … cooking time for spatchcock turkey per pound https://jlhsolutionsinc.com

Main diagonal - Wikipedia

Nettettype arrayName [ x ] [ y ]; Where type can be any valid C data type and arrayName will be a valid C identifier. Below is the source code for C Program to print diagonal elements of a Matrix which is successfully compiled and run on Windows System to produce desired output as shown below : SOURCE CODE : : Nettet9. apr. 2024 · Define a function print_diagonals that takes a 2D list (matrix) as input. Get the length of the matrix and store it in the variable n. Use a list comprehension to … Nettet23. mar. 2016 · We then call spdiags to define where along the diagonal of this matrix this vector will be populating. We want to define the main diagonal to have all ones as well … cooking time for spiral ham bone in

C Exercises: Find the sum of left diagonals of a matrix

Category:Java Program to Compute the Sum of Diagonals of a Matrix

Tags:Left diagonal of a matrix

Left diagonal of a matrix

How to add left diagonal of a 2D square matrix using user-defined ...

Nettet19. nov. 2024 · You can acomplish this with numpy.triu_indices.I have commented below each step to guide you through it. Basically you get the upper right indices with numpy.triu_indices and loop over them to get the elements. You sum all of the elements except the ones in the diagonal. Nettet28. nov. 2012 · If you're trying to zero out diagonals that go "the other way" (from bottom left to top right), you could do something like use the "flipud" function: A = flipud (flipud (A) - diag (diag (flipud (A),3),3)). Again, numbering goes from -7 to 7. – snooze_bear Nov 28, 2012 at 20:52 Show 2 more comments 0

Left diagonal of a matrix

Did you know?

Nettet6. jan. 2024 · To handle an equal matrix, all you need is the length of the matrix. Below I show how to get the diagonal length and how to create your left and right diagonals using a for loop. This does not account for the case where the length and width are not equal, instead it will break short since the diagonal length is the smaller of the 2 dimensions. Nettet21. jan. 2024 · I am trying to find the sum of the elements of the left diagonal of a 2D matrix. But it shows the following error:.\sum_matrix.cpp: In function 'int main()': …

Nettet28. nov. 2012 · 2. I believe you can use: M = M - diag (diag (M,k),k); where k is 0 for the main diagonal, negative for the lower diagonals (up to -7), positive for the upper … Nettet16. sep. 2024 · When a matrix is similar to a diagonal matrix, the matrix is said to be diagonalizable. We define a diagonal matrix D as a matrix containing a zero in every …

Nettet5. mar. 2024 · The identity matrix has "1" elements along the main diagonal, and "0" elements in all other positions. Perform row operations to reduce the matrix until the left side is in row-echelon form, then continue reducing until the left side is the identity matrix. Once the operation is complete, your matrix will be in the form [I B -1 ].

Nettet9. nov. 2024 · // Get diagonals starting in the first row with a column > 0 for (int col = array.length - 1; col > 0; col--) { getDiagonal (array, 0, col); } // Get all diagonals starting from the left most column for (int row = 0; row < array.length; row++) { …

The operations of matrix addition and matrix multiplication are especially simple for diagonal matrices. Write diag(a1, ..., an) for a diagonal matrix whose diagonal entries starting in the upper left corner are a1, ..., an. Then, for addition, we have diag(a1, ..., an) + diag(b1, ..., bn) = diag(a1 + b1, ..., an + bn) and for … Se mer In linear algebra, a diagonal matrix is a matrix in which the entries outside the main diagonal are all zero; the term usually refers to square matrices. Elements of the main diagonal can either be zero or nonzero. An example … Se mer The inverse matrix-to-vector $${\displaystyle \operatorname {diag} }$$ operator is sometimes denoted by the identically named Se mer Multiplying a vector by a diagonal matrix multiplies each of the terms by the corresponding diagonal entry. Given a diagonal matrix This can be … Se mer • The determinant of diag(a1, ..., an) is the product a1⋯an. • The adjugate of a diagonal matrix is again diagonal. • Where all matrices are square, • The identity matrix In and zero matrix are diagonal. Se mer As stated above, a diagonal matrix is a matrix in which all off-diagonal entries are zero. That is, the matrix D = (di,j) with n columns and n rows is diagonal if However, the main diagonal entries are unrestricted. The term diagonal … Se mer A diagonal matrix with equal diagonal entries is a scalar matrix; that is, a scalar multiple λ of the identity matrix I. Its effect on a Se mer As explained in determining coefficients of operator matrix, there is a special basis, e1, ..., en, for which the matrix $${\displaystyle \mathbf {A} }$$ takes the diagonal form. Hence, … Se mer family guy for xboxNettet17. sep. 2024 · Therefore, it is easy to take powers of a diagonal matrix: (x 0 0 0 y 0 0 0 z)n = (xn 0 0 0 yn 0 0 0 zn). By Fact 5.3.1 in Section 5.3, if A = CDC − 1 then An = CDnC − 1, so it is also easy to take powers of diagonalizable matrices. This will be very important in applications to difference equations in Section 5.6. cooking time for stuffed turkeyNettet11. jun. 2013 · You can represent your matrix using 2-dimensional array, char [] [] matrix = char [] [] Then you can use for loops to iterate thorough it and extract the out put you … cooking time for stuffed cornish game hensNettetfor 1 dag siden · An Upper triangular matrix is a squared matrix that has the same number of rows and columns and all the elements that are present below the main … cooking time for small meatloafNettet12. mai 2024 · print one reverse diagonal starting from a generic matrix [i, j] element, basically decrementing i and j by 1 in every cycle if both i and j are >= 0, otherwise … family guy fortnite mapNettet17. mar. 2024 · antidiagonal ( plural antidiagonals ) ( linear algebra) The diagonal of a matrix that leads from top-right towards bottom-left. Synonyms [ edit] counterdiagonal secondary diagonal minor diagonal Derived terms [ edit] antidiagonally Translations [ edit] the diagonal of a matrix that leads from top-right towards bottom-left See also [ edit] cooking time for standing rib roast at 325Nettet4. mar. 2024 · Find sum of left diagonals of a matrix : ----- Input the size of the square matrix : 2 Input elements in the first matrix : element - [0],[0] : 1 element - [0],[1] : 2 … cooking time for squash